> Please, review the following `interp-only` issue related to carrier threads. > There are 3 problems fixed here: > - The `EnterInterpOnlyModeClosure::do_threads` is taking the > `JvmtiThreadState` with the `jt->jvmti_thread_state()` which is incorrect > when we have a deal with a carrier thread. The target state is known at the > point when the `HandshakeClosure` is set, so the fix is to pass it as a > constructor parameter. > - The `state->is_pending_interp_only_mode())` was processed at mounts only > but it has to be processed for unmounts as well. > - The test > `test/hotspot/jtreg/serviceability/jvmti/vthread/MethodExitTest/libMethodExitTest.cpp` > has a wrong assumption that there can't be `MethodExit` event on the carrier > thread when the function `breakpoint_hit1` is being executed. However, it can > happen if the virtual thread gets unmounted. > > The fix also includes new test case `vthread/CarrierThreadEventNotification` > developed by Patricio. > > Testing: > - Ran new test case locally > - Ran mach5 tiers 1-6 This pull request has now been integrated.
